2 Tahoe businesses honored for climate-smart strategies

Two of the 19 businesses recognized by the California Air Resources Board for leadership and making notable, voluntary achievements toward reducing their carbon footprint are from Lake Tahoe.

Elevated Fitness in South Lake Tahoe and Granlibakken Resort in Tahoe City were among the business that took a number of different actions to save money and improve their business operations while reducing greenhouse gas emissions and environmental impacts.

Some of the steps the 19 businesses took included installing LED lights, solar panels, and energy-efficient equipment; manufacturing biodiesel or using biodiesel fueled vehicles; eliminating toxic chemicals and solvents; using eco-friendly, recycled/reused/repurposed products; composting food scraps and plant material; and starting or enhancing recycling and water conservation programs.
